Front Region
A term from Erving Goffman's dramaturgical analysis referring to social settings where individuals perform specific roles for an audience, adhering to societal norms and expectations.
Social Darwinism
A theory that applies the concepts of natural selection and survival of the fittest to human societies, often used to justify social policies that maintain societal inequalities.
Moral Poverty
The lack of moral values, principles, and responsibilities, often leading to social problems such as crime and antisocial behavior.
The Veil
A metaphor for the barrier or separation between different realities or perceptions, often in a cultural or racial context.
